Webb27 okt. 2024 · The inheritance tax exemptions in the Netherlands are as follows: 21.282 euros on inheritances from parents to children / grandchildren. 2.208 euros on inheritances from any other person. 671.910 euros between tax partners. 50.397 euros on inheritance from children to their parents. 63.836 euros from parents to their child who has a disability. You can reduce the rate of inheritance tax payable from 40% to 36% if you leave at least 10% of the value of your estate to charity.
